Product Overview

The Honeywell MLF-AD04C stands as a high-tier solution for precision data acquisition within complex industrial automation ecosystems. This 4-channel analog input module bridges the gap between field-level sensors and the controller, providing a sophisticated interface for both voltage and current signals. With a remarkable 1/16000 resolution, the MLF-AD04C captures minute fluctuations in process variables—such as pressure, flow, and temperature—translating them into actionable digital data with surgical accuracy. Engineered for high-speed environments, it delivers a conversion rate of 1.0 ms per channel, making it indispensable for real-time process control in chemical processing, power generation, and advanced manufacturing. Its ability to handle diverse signal types on a single module optimizes rack space and reduces overall system complexity.

Signal Processing and Hardware Architecture

The MLF-AD04C utilizes an advanced Analog-to-Digital conversion architecture designed to mitigate industrial noise and signal drift. Each of its four channels operates independently, allowing for mixed-signal configurations—such as running 4-20mA loops alongside 0-10V voltage inputs simultaneously. The module incorporates a robust ±15V absolute maximum input protection circuit, shielding the internal logic from field-side voltage spikes or wiring errors. Communication with the host controller is streamlined through a 64-point I/O map, ensuring high-bandwidth data throughput. The physical interface employs a 15-point terminal block, providing secure, vibration-resistant landing points for field instrumentation wiring, essential for maintaining signal integrity in high-vibration machinery environments.

Technical Specifications

Attribute Specification
Manufacturer Honeywell
Model Number MLF-AD04C
Input Channels 4 Channels (Isolated/Configurable)
Resolution 1/16000 (14-bit equivalent accuracy)
Conversion Speed 1.0 ms / Channel
Input Ranges 4-20mA, 0-20mA, 1-5V, 0-5V, 0-10V, -10 to +10V
Overvoltage Protection ±15V Absolute Maximum
I/O Points Occupied 64 Points
Weight 0.4 kg (0.5 kg gross)
Dimensions 7.0 x 14.0 x 14.5 cm
Country of Origin USA
HS Code 8537101190

Field Installation and Wiring Standards

To ensure maximum accuracy, field engineers should utilize shielded twisted-pair (STP) cabling for all analog inputs to the MLF-AD04C. The 15-point terminal block must be wired with specific attention to the "Common" return paths to avoid ground loops that can degrade the 1/16000 resolution. When installing in high-interference environments, ensure the module's frame ground is tied to a clean instrumentation earth. We recommend maintaining a minimum clearance from high-voltage AC power lines within the cabinet. For 4-20mA current loops, verify the external loop power supply stability, as the module functions as a passive receiver in standard configurations.

Technical FAQs

Q1: Can I mix voltage and current inputs on the same MLF-AD04C module?

A1: Yes. Each of the four channels is individually configurable via the system software, allowing you to monitor a mix of current loops (e.g., 4-20mA) and voltage signals (e.g., 0-10V) simultaneously on one module.

Q2: How does the 1.0 ms conversion speed affect my control loop?

A2: A conversion speed of 1.0 ms per channel ensures that your PID loops receive nearly real-time data, which is essential for fast-acting processes like pressure regulation or high-speed motor control.

Q3: What protection does the module have against wiring errors?

A3: The MLF-AD04C features an absolute maximum input rating of ±15V. This hardware-level protection prevents internal circuit damage if a standard 24V signal is accidentally miswired to a voltage-sensitive input, up to the rated limit.

Q4: Does the module require periodic calibration?

A4: While the module is factory-calibrated for high precision, we recommend an annual loop check through the DCS interface to account for any drift in the field-side sensors or cabling resistance.
